CRIME NEWS

  • Cheyenne Animal Shelter rescued over 75 animals (including dogs, cats, rabbits, chickens, small birds, and a goat) from a neglected property where some were found near dead animals last Friday with treatment costs estimated at $150,000 as the investigation continues.  KING FM

ECONOMY NEWS

  • Gas prices in Wyoming averaged $3.00 per gallon today — with the cheapest at $2.55 and the priciest at $3.99 — according to GasBuddy's survey of 494 stations. Prices increased slightly over the past week while remaining lower than last month’s levels, and national averages are falling as well.  KING FM
  • Laramie County’s average gas price rose 8 cents to $2.82 per gallon today — national prices dropped 6.4 cents to about $3.02 per gallon.  Cap City News

GOVERNMENT NEWS

  • Wyoming law passed in 2024 now fines drivers who ignore wind-related road closures, with a first offense carrying a $1,000 fine and up to 30 days in jail—repeat offenses result in a $2,500 fine and apply to all high-profile vehicles.  KGAB

SPORTS NEWS

  • Wyoming will debut new black-and-white coal-inspired uniforms on Oct. 25 when the team hosts Colorado State in the final Border War meeting as Mountain West members — the game will be played at 5:30 p.m. on CBS Sports Network and will honor local coal miners with a premium fan giveaway.  KGAB
  • At War Memorial Stadium last Saturday, Wyoming defensive back Desman Hearns slowed San Jose State receiver Danny Scudero — who had 151 yards and four touchdowns in the first half — but the Cowboys rallied with 21 unanswered points in the fourth quarter to win 35—28.  KGAB
